Photograph of Mr. and Mrs. Harry Daniels standing on a paved walkway beside their house. There is a border of flowering shrubs beside the house; a yard and picket fence are in the background.
Photograph of the Bob Ferguson, teacher at the Whaletown school; his parents; his wife Ethel; and children in their home. The photograph has been marked up by Gilean Douglas for use as an illustration for one of her articles, and has a typed caption taped to the bottom.

Photograph of Mr. and Mrs. Christmas, their boat "Gwa-Yee" behind them, with two boys, the sons of a teacher at one of the First Nations villages in their mission area.

Photograph of Kathleen Boas and her two daughters loading the "Rendezvous" at the Whaletown wharf. The Whaletown store is at upper left; the freight shed just to the right of the ramp, with the fuel shed to its right. Captioned "Boas family coming aboard with everything for the trip."
